The Ladybug Transistor
follow on the fediverse: @[email protected]
Clutching Stems
2011-06-07
Can't Wait Another Day
2007-06-05
Here Comes the Rain EP
2006-10-31
The Ladybug Transistor
2003
Argyle Heir
2001-07-30
The Albemarle Sound
1999-03-23
Beverley Atonale
1997-02-11
Marlborough Farms
1995-10-04
Live at Emmabodafestivalen 99
2008-06-14: NYC Popfest, Music Hall of Williamsburg, Brooklyn, NY USA